About Resin Patios

A resin patio is laid as one continuous surface, so there are no joints for moss and weeds to get into and nothing to settle unevenly the way an individual slab can. It flows around curves and steps without cut lines, and because it is permeable, rain drains through rather than sitting in puddles. It works particularly well running out from bi-fold doors, where a flush, unbroken surface reads as an extension of the room.

Resin Patios costs

No two jobs price the same, and anyone quoting over the phone without seeing it is guessing. These are the things that actually move the number, and the visit to work them out is free.

  • The area of the patio
  • Aggregate colour and blend
  • The base required, which depends on what is there now
  • Level changes and steps
  • Weather, since resin needs dry conditions to lay

Resin Patios: common questions

Do weeds grow through a resin patio?

There are no joints for them to root in, which is the main advantage over slabs. Anything that appears has blown in and sits on the surface rather than growing up through it.

Can resin run right up to bi-fold doors?

Yes, and it is one of the best reasons to choose it. Because it is trowelled out with no cut lines, you can finish flush at the threshold so the inside floor and the patio read as one surface.
